Dia's family situation and the politics surrounding her magical genius are given more depth in the source material. The pressure on her, the expectations, the way other nobles view her—it's a more fleshed-out subplot. In the anime, it serves more as a motivation for her character and a backdrop for her relationship with Lugh, rather than a fully explored element of the world.

Lugh's relationship with his family—his new parents—is explored with more nuance in the text. His calculated respect for his father, his understanding of his mother's kindness, and the complicated feelings of being an old soul in a child's body within a loving family are given more interior monologue. The anime shows the family being caring, but the novel makes you feel the strange, poignant distance Lugh maintains even as he appreciates them.

Is The World Finest Assassin based on a manga?

4 Answers2025-09-10 07:40:59
Man, 'The World's Finest Assassin Gets Reincarnated in Another World as an Aristocrat' is such a wild ride! I stumbled upon the anime first, binged it in one sitting, and then went digging for more. Turns out, it's actually based on a light novel series written by Rui Tsukiyo and illustrated by Reia. The light novel started in 2019, and the manga adaptation came later in 2020, illustrated by Hamao. What's cool is how the manga expands on certain scenes with Reia's gorgeous artwork—especially those tense assassination sequences. The anime blends both sources but adds its own flair too. What is the plot of The World Finest Assassin?

5 Answers2025-09-10 09:00:33
Man, 'The World's Finest Assassin Gets Reincarnated in Another World as an Aristocrat' is such a wild ride! The story follows this legendary hitman who gets betrayed and killed, only to be reincarnated into a fantasy world by a goddess who wants him to assassinate the 'Hero' before the guy goes berserk and destroys everything. What really hooked me was how the protagonist uses his modern-world knowledge—chemistry, tactics, even psychology—to build a new life as a noble's son while secretly preparing for his mission. The way he trains his magic and crafts tools (poison lipstick? Genius!) makes it feel like a spy thriller mixed with fantasy.
